Hi team, I see the error "Invalid FormID!" flooding my otrs 5.0.42.
I guess this came up after installing a package but I do not know how to find the the answer
How to troubleshoot this, since OTRS is not giving me a starting point.

Re: Invalid FormID!
A quick grep of the apache error log revealed, that the otrs is unable to get to this address:
Can't perform GET on https://ftp.otrs.org/pub/otrs/misc/pack ... sitory.xml: 500 Can't connect to ftp.otrs.org:443
It really is offline, when pasting the link into the browser.
